Here are some tips to help you write a good argument paper:

  1. Choose a clear and specific topic: Before you start writing, it is important to choose a topic that is specific and focused. This will help you stay on track and ensure that your argument is clear and concise. Avoid choosing a topic that is too broad or vague, as this will make it difficult to provide a strong and well-supported argument.

  2. Do your research: In order to write a good argument paper, it is essential to back up your claims with evidence. This could include research from academic sources, statistics, or expert testimony. Take the time to thoroughly research your topic and gather evidence to support your argument.

  3. Create an outline: An outline is a helpful tool for organizing your thoughts and ensuring that your paper flows smoothly. Start by outlining the main points you want to make and the evidence you will use to support them. You can then organize these points into a logical structure that supports your overall argument.

  4. Write a clear and concise thesis statement: Your thesis statement is the main argument of your paper, and it should be clearly stated in the introduction. Make sure your thesis is specific and well-defined, and avoid using vague or general statements.

  5. Use strong and persuasive language: When writing your argument paper, it is important to use language that is clear, concise, and persuasive. Avoid using overly complex or technical language, and aim to make your argument accessible to a general audience. Use strong verbs and concise sentences to make your points effectively.

  6. Anticipate counterarguments: A good argument paper should not only present your own perspective, but also anticipate and address counterarguments. This will show that you have considered multiple viewpoints and can effectively respond to opposing arguments.

  7. Use strong transitions: Transitions are the connections between your ideas, and they help to make your paper flow smoothly. Use strong transitions to clearly connect your ideas and help the reader follow your argument.

By following these tips, you can write a clear and persuasive argument paper that effectively presents your perspective and supports your argument with evidence.
